### Audit Item 07: Session-Token Refresh Bug

Reviewers, give this one extra attention: the Lockmere session service had a bug where refreshed tokens kept the old expiry, letting stale sessions linger past logout. Confirm the fix invalidates the prior token atomically and that the regression test actually exercises the refresh path, not just issuance. Any follow-up patches touching token lifetimes need sign-off from the engineer accountable for this area, named below.

signatory, kahog-yageg: Sorix Kasath Wenir

Handover — Warranty Overrun, Pellix Range

From Director Ames to Director Korval, for heads of department.

Warranty claims on the Pellix range are running forty percent above plan. Root cause: seal failures from the Brundale supplier batch. Recall scope decided; reserve topped up last quarter. Supplier renegotiation underway — Korval owns it from Monday. Service network briefed, comms script approved. Do not discuss externally. Keep claims reporting weekly until the rate normalises. One restricted item appended below.

board note of bawep-tajef: Queniusek Systems plans to raise the Quenvan list price by 53.1 percent in March. The pricing group signed off on a budget of $176.4 million for Project Drueth. The renewal with Casionix Partners closes at $142.5 million a year, 8.3 percent below the last contract. Project Fraax slips by six weeks because of the tooling delay.

## Break-Glass: Ormwright Legacy Layer

Context for weekly sync: the Ormwright ORM refactor is mid-flight. Old mapper and new query layer run side by side behind a flag. If the new layer corrupts writes, break-glass reverts all traffic to legacy in one step. Do not flip the flag manually; use the revert console only. Requires two approvals, logged automatically. Revert is safe to run twice. The console prompts once, then asks for the recovery passphrase shown below.

strongbox words: sorir-belvan-rusix-ulays-ralmir-praix-eliir-tamax-praael-druael-julir-tamius-jorir

// USER_MODULE_EXTRACTION_PHASE — tracks the current cutover stage as we
// split the user module out of the Cordwell monolith. Security note:
// while this is < 3, session validation still happens in the monolith,
// so the extracted service must not mint tokens itself. The migration
// build that set this value is identified by the token below.

pipeline stamp: htk3_69f